Output 74a8dea9b6abfe4065f76c1f8250fc84dbce25c876ef82de9c7658220ea2185e:0

value
2744892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e4d376bff389279aa978fb631b0b1c3bdf46329 OP_EQUAL
address
35uqWTreHCyruFU8iaZFRt5yMarUTQ1pAk
transaction
74a8dea9b6abfe4065f76c1f8250fc84dbce25c876ef82de9c7658220ea2185e
spent
true